在享受Linux系统带来的稳定性和灵活性时,我们时常会遇到系统运行速度缓慢的问题。尤其是对于老旧的Ubuntu 14.04系统,优化配置以提升速度显得尤为重要。今天,就让我来带你轻松配置锐速,让你的Ubuntu系统焕发新活力。
了解锐速
锐速(Varnish Cache)是一款高性能的HTTP加速缓存软件,它通过缓存静态资源来减少服务器负载,从而提高网站访问速度。对于Ubuntu 14.04系统,配置锐速可以有效提升系统响应速度。
配置锐速
1. 安装Varnish
首先,我们需要安装Varnish。打开终端,执行以下命令:
sudo apt-get update
sudo apt-get install varnish
安装完成后,启动Varnish服务:
sudo systemctl start varnish
2. 配置Varnish
接下来,我们需要配置Varnish。首先,创建一个名为default.vcl的文件,并将其放置在/etc/varnish/目录下:
sudo nano /etc/varnish/default.vcl
在default.vcl文件中,添加以下内容:
vcl 4.0;
backend default {
.host = "127.0.0.1";
.port = "8080";
}
sub vcl_init {
new thread->http->start();
}
sub vcl_recv {
if (req.method == "GET") {
return (hash);
}
}
sub vcl_hit {
return (deliver);
}
sub vcl_miss {
return (fetch);
}
sub vcl_deliver {
set resp.http.Cache-Control = "max-age=3600";
}
保存并关闭文件。
3. 修改Nginx配置
为了让Varnish能够与Nginx协同工作,我们需要修改Nginx配置。首先,创建一个名为varnish.conf的文件,并将其放置在/etc/nginx/sites-available/目录下:
sudo nano /etc/nginx/sites-available/varnish.conf
在varnish.conf文件中,添加以下内容:
server {
listen 80;
location / {
proxy_pass http://127.0.0.1:8080;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_set_header X-Forwarded-Proto $scheme;
}
}
保存并关闭文件。
接下来,创建一个软链接,将varnish.conf文件链接到/etc/nginx/sites-enabled/目录:
sudo ln -s /etc/nginx/sites-available/varnish.conf /etc/nginx/sites-enabled/
最后,重启Nginx和Varnish服务:
sudo systemctl restart nginx
sudo systemctl restart varnish
4. 测试锐速配置
在浏览器中访问你的网站,如果一切正常,你应该能看到页面加载速度明显提升。
总结
通过以上步骤,我们已经成功配置了锐速,让你的Ubuntu 14.04系统速度得到了显著提升。当然,这只是优化系统速度的一个方面,你还可以通过其他方法,如清理垃圾文件、更新系统等,来进一步提升系统性能。希望这篇文章能帮助你,祝你使用愉快!
